Weekly Tuning - Lēsa Calibration Process

What this is: A repeatable weekly check-in to tune Lēsa's performance, catch drift, and evolve capabilities.

Why it exists: Without periodic calibration, agents drift - memory degrades, principles get forgotten, patterns emerge that aren't captured. This is preventive maintenance.

How to use:

# Weekly (or as needed):
1. Open WEEKLY-CALIBRATION.md
2. Go through each section with Lēsa
3. Capture notes in a dated file: notes/YYYY-MM-DD.md
4. Make adjustments to SOUL.md, AGENTS.md, or system config
5. Commit changes

Sections:

  1. Memory Check - Can Lēsa recall key events? Are memory files current?
  2. Performance Review - What's working? What's not?
  3. SOUL.md Alignment - Are thinking principles being applied?
  4. System Health - Memory system, plugins, config all healthy?
  5. Observations & Evolution - Patterns noticed, proposals for changes
  6. Tuning & Adjustments - What needs to change based on above?
  7. Next Week Focus - Specific goals/areas to improve

Philosophy:

This process itself should evolve. After 4-6 weeks, review what's useful vs busywork and update accordingly.
